An aspect of pragmatic nationalism is the tendency to aggressively court FDI believed to be in the national interest by, for example, offering subsidies to foreign MNEs in the form of tax breaks or grants.

Jay's Treaty

A 1794 agreement between the United States and Great Britain that aimed to resolve issues remaining since the American Revolution and to facilitate ten years of peaceful trade between the two countries.

Mary Wollstonecraft

An English writer and advocate for women's rights, recognized for her work "A Vindication of the Rights of Woman" (1792), which argued for the education and equality of women.

Gender Roles

Social and cultural expectations regarding the behaviors, actions, and roles deemed appropriate for individuals based on their gender.

Revolutionary War

The conflict between the Thirteen American colonies and Great Britain from 1775 to 1783, leading to the independence of the United States.
